Today's prayer times for Bardwell, United States are calculated using precise astronomical data via the Offline Calculation (Adhan) method. Fajr begins at 04:36 and ends at sunrise (05:56), giving approximately 80 minutes for the pre-dawn prayer. Isha starts at 21:10.
Tahajjud time in Bardwell today is 01:40. Tahajjud is the voluntary night prayer performed in the final third of the night, between Isha (21:10) and the beginning of Fajr (04:36). Islamic midnight in Bardwell is 00:12.
Qibla direction from Bardwell is 48° (NE) from North. Suhoor must be completed before Imsak at 04:36, and Iftar begins at Maghrib (19:49).
